Historical Event on 1/20/1948
1. Bomb exploded near Birla House during a prayer meeting of Gandhi. 2. Three member UN Commission for investigation/mediation on Kashmir. 3. K.M. Cariappa succeeded Lieutenant General D. Rissell as the Army Commander, Delhi and East Punjab and was responsible for conducting the operation in Kashmir.
